By the numbers, the 2026 FIFA World Cup was a resounding success, with the final between Spain and Argentina earning a combined 66 million viewers between the English and Spanish broadcasts.
More reporting around the 2026 World Cup has revealed that Infantino was far from the only one endowing undeserved benefits to politically connected stakeholders.
According to TheTexasVoice.com, “politicians, a television news anchor, and a labor union that is active in Democratic Party politics – were among those who received free World Cup tickets from the component of Harris County government that runs NRG Park.”
One of the beneficiaries, Daniella Guzman, a news anchor from KPRC-TV, was given three tickets to the June 17 Portugal-DR Congo match.
As much unity as the 2026 World Cup brought, it also served as a stark reminder of how the political class, and those connected to it, play by their own set of rules.
